A new enhancement ensures that workstations remain powered on during scheduled Workstation Tasks . You no longer have to worry about a machine slipping into sleep mode halfway through a critical update or patch cycle. Deep Freeze 8.63 Patch

In the world of IT administration and public computing, maintaining a pristine system state is a constant battle. Between accidental file deletions, malware infections, and unauthorized configuration changes, "system drift" is inevitable. This is where Faronics Deep Freeze becomes an essential tool.
